all u have to do, is just cut the the peg off the spindle, then glue it back on the spindle at the top. simple as that.just remember, when the peg is cut and glued, it becomes weaker.
pics we need pics, this is more of a drawing of what a dropped spindle looks like than a howto.
And heres a hint- instead of just hacking off the spindle and re-gluing it which is indeed very weak and shorter to boot- hack it off and drill a small hole for a new spindle made from a styrene rod. THis will be very strong.
